What is story writing?

Story writing is the creative process of crafting narratives that can entertain, inform, or inspire readers. It involves developing characters, plots, settings, and themes to build a compelling and cohesive story. Story writers use their imagination and writing skills to convey ideas and emotions, and stories can be found in books, movies, television, and other media. The process can include brainstorming, outlining, drafting, revising, and editing to produce a finished piece. Story writing is a vital skill for authors, screenwriters, and anyone interested in creative communication.

What is the difference between Story Writing vs Copywriting?

AspectStory WritingCopywriting
Primary FocusCreating engaging narratives and stories for entertainment or educational purposesWriting persuasive content to promote products or services
Work EnvironmentFiction and non-fiction publishing, media, entertainmentAdvertising agencies, marketing departments, digital media
Required SkillsCreativity, storytelling, character developmentPersuasion, marketing knowledge, concise writing
Common UsageNovels, scripts, articles, blogsAdvertisements, sales pages, email campaigns

While both story writing and copywriting involve writing skills, story writing focuses on crafting engaging narratives for entertainment or education, whereas copywriting aims to persuade audiences to take action. Understanding these differences helps professionals choose the right career path or project focus.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a story writer?

To thrive as a Story Writer, you need strong creative writing skills, a solid grasp of narrative structure, and proficiency in grammar and language, often demonstrated through a degree in English, creative writing, or related experience. Familiarity with word processing software and editing tools like Microsoft Word, Scrivener, or Google Docs is common in the field. Exceptional imagination, attention to detail, and the ability to accept and incorporate feedback help writers stand out. These skills are essential for producing compelling, polished stories that engage readers and meet industry standards.

What are some common challenges story writers face when collaborating with editors and other creatives?

Story writers often collaborate closely with editors, illustrators, and sometimes marketing teams, especially in publishing or content creation environments. A common challenge is balancing creative vision with editorial feedback, as writers may need to revise their work to meet publication standards or audience expectations. Additionally, coordinating deadlines and ensuring consistency across different contributors can require strong communication and adaptability. Successful writers are open to constructive criticism and able to adjust their narratives while maintaining their unique voice.

The Role

Lumen Technologies is seeking an experienced communications leader to help elevate the story of Lumen's infrastructure services while supporting incident communications for network outages. The Senior Lead Manager, Network Infrastructure & Incident Communications, role leads strategic messaging for Lumen's infrastructure platforms, partnering closely with the infrastructure team to tell the story of Lumen's core network, services, and operational foundations that enable global connectivity. The role also supports incident messaging for service disruptions, coordinates timely and accurate communications with internal and external stakeholders, and assists with media engagement as needed.

The Main Responsibilities
  • Partner with Lumen's infrastructure leaders to identify and develop proactive storytelling opportunities (e.g., network expansions, upgrades, resiliency investments, sustainability and innovation initiatives), translating technical work into clear narratives that support business priorities.
  • Drive proactive media relations that move beyond reactive press activity. Identify and prioritize high-impact outlets and influencers; build and sustain trusted journalist relationships; monitor the news cycle for emerging narratives; and develop creative, timely pitch angles that position Lumen executives as authoritative voices on AI networking, infrastructure resilience, and enterprise transformation.
  • Act as a strategic advisor to executives and business leaders, ensuring external communications are aligned to business objectives, grounded in an informed point of view, and delivered with consistency, clarity, and credibility across proactive and reactive moments.
  • Help anticipate, mitigate, and manage reputational risk by identifying emerging issues early, shaping messaging strategies that protect and strengthen the Lumen brand, and ensuring all communications reinforce trust, transparency, and credibility with key stakeholders.
  • Draft press releases, messaging, talking points, and briefing materials, while leading spokesperson preparation and coordinating media interviews, including pitching, scheduling, and follow-up.
  • Lead end-to-end communications for network outages and service disruptions, including drafting incident messaging, FAQs, and talking points, and coordinating closely with network operations, incident leaders, legal and other stakeholders to gather approvals and ensure accuracy.
  • Field and respond to media inquiries and support proactive outreach related to outages, service reliability, and high-impact issues to provide timely statements, accurate updates, and approved messaging.
  • Develop and maintain playbooks, templates, and messaging governance for outages to drive repeatable execution and brand consistency.
  • Monitor and analyze issue and outage communications effectiveness (e.g., stakeholder feedback, channel performance, media coverage) and recommend improvements to process and messaging.
What We Look For in a Candidate
  • Bachelor's degree in Communications, Journalism, Public Relations, or a related field (or equivalent experience).
  • Significant experience leading high-stakes, time-sensitive communications in a complex organization (e.g., incident response, crisis/issues management, corporate communications, or technology communications).
  • Demonstrated ability to translate technical information into clear, audience-appropriate messaging for customers, employees, executives, and external stakeholders.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including executive-level briefing, message discipline, and media-ready writing.
  • Proven project management and operational skills with the ability to pivot quickly in a fast-paced environment.
  • Strong judgment, analytical skills, and discretion when managing sensitive information and reputational risk.
  • Demonstrated experience developing proactive media strategies and story pitches, securing interviews, and preparing spokespeople with succinct messaging and anticipated Q&A.
  • Strong ability to build trusted relationships with highly technical teams and convert infrastructure roadmaps, milestones, and performance improvements into audience-relevant narratives for media and external stakeholders.

About Lumen Technologies

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Lumen Technologies, headquartered in Monroe, LA, US, is a leader in the telecommunications industry. The company provides an array of solutions ranging from voice, broadband, and video services for consumers, businesses, and governmental agencies. Additionally, they offer data management, cloud, network, and IT services for enterprise customers. Lumen Technologies was founded in 1930, originally as the Louisiana Long Distance Independent Telephone Company. The company’s mission is to further human progress through technology, promoting a robust digital ecosystem, which is reflective of their core values of trust, respect, and innovative problem-solving that aims to have a significant impact on their clients' businesses.
